Another citizen has joined the ranks of Lithuanian millionaires. As announced by lottery organizers, the million-dollar prize went to a player who purchased a ticket in an unusual way.
Donatas Kazlauskas, Deputy General Director of "Olifėja", spoke more about the million-dollar win.
– Is there already a winner?
– All we know is that the winner bought the ticket online and we informed him. Unfortunately, he has not responded yet. We are really waiting for him to come to our office to arrange all the necessary documents so that the winnings can be paid out.
– It must be very difficult to realize that you won and that this is not some kind of fraud.
– Of course. When I talk to people, they admit that it was a big shock for them. First, they share their impressions with their loved ones, and then they come to our representative office to make sure that everything is really so, and that they are not fooling around. When they receive official confirmations, arranged documents and can collect their winnings, then they calm down and are truly happy with the results they have achieved.
– How much tax do I need to pay?
– There is no need to pay taxes, because the lottery turnover itself is taxable. This is the practice in most European countries – all winnings go directly to the winner's account.
– What is the biggest win in Lithuania? What amounts have Lithuanians won?
– The biggest win is 81 million euros.

Sigita Strockytė-Varnė, personal finance expert at SEB Bank, commented in more detail on what to do with unexpected money.
– How to deal with a win of this size?
– When this happens, to put it simply, the mind becomes clouded – emotions become very strong and take over. And when emotions are high, the probability of mistakes is also very high. For this reason, historically, those who win millions usually return to the same financial situation a few years later, and sometimes even to an even worse one.
– What to do now?
– The first and most important piece of advice is to take your time and wait until your emotions calm down. The realization that you have won such an unimaginable amount of money comes gradually – sometimes you have to wait half a year or even a year. The second step is to find a reliable financial advisor or expert who can help you create a strategy on how to divide and distribute this winning amount and how to create sources of passive income. It is important not only to spend the winning amount, but also to ensure that it continues to generate income.
The third step is the distribution of money. Some of the funds should remain in liquid instruments, such as term deposits. Another part could be allocated to low-risk financial instruments, such as government bonds. Another part of the money, after consulting with experts, can be allocated to long-term goals - real estate or a dream business. Undoubtedly, the winner's life changes. If he does not forget to invest in his financial education, his life and that of his loved ones may change radically and never return to the previous level.
– I've heard it said that the average person perceives a million as a very large sum, and anything over a million is a sum that is difficult to comprehend at all. Is that true?
– Indeed, yes. For Lithuanians, a few million is a hard-to-understand amount, because our average income is much lower. An interesting fact is that if a person, earning 2000 euros a month, did not spend a cent and saved all his money, he would accumulate two million only after 83 years. And if we also take into account inflation and currency depreciation, this period becomes even longer. For this reason, winners experience strong emotions – they want to buy something right away, spend money spontaneously and as a result, mistakes occur. Therefore, taking your time can help you save money and invest it wisely.
